Factors Affecting Cost
- Lawn Size: Larger lawns require more time and resources to maintain, increasing the overall cost.
- Frequency of Service: More frequent maintenance visits can lead to higher costs but ensure a well-kept lawn.
- Type of Service: Different services, such as mowing, fertilizing, and pest control, each have their own costs.
- Condition of Lawn: Lawns in poor condition may need additional treatments, leading to higher expenses.
- Seasonal Needs: Certain times of the year may require more intensive care, such as aeration in the spring or leaf removal in the fall.
- Local Climate: The warm, humid climate in Saint Johns, FL, can influence the types of services needed and their frequency.
- Labor Costs: The cost of labor can vary based on the expertise and reputation of the lawn care provider.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Saint Johns, FL) |
---|---|
Lawn Mowing | $30 - $50 per visit |
Fertilization | $50 - $80 per application |
Aeration | $75 - $150 per service |
Weed Control | $40 - $60 per application |
Pest Control | $50 - $100 per treatment |
Leaf Removal | $75 - $150 per service |
Sod Installation | $1 - $2 per square foot |
Mulching | $50 - $100 per cubic yard |
Shrub Trimming | $50 - $100 per hour |
Irrigation System Check | $75 - $150 per visit |
